Santa Rosa Beach Surprise!


Serendipity ... is a fortunate happenstance ... a pleasant surprise ...


After an interesting morning at the weekly market and wandering around the village of Rosemary Beach we continued with our "Sunday Drive" along the scenic highway 30A. 

This is our first time in the Panhandle region of Florida; although several years ago we did look at visiting the area.


We had found a lovely two bed/two bathroom apartment located in Santa Rosa beach, but timing was not right ...we didn't know exactly where it was located, just had a photo image in my mind of the property that I had seen on the vacation rental website.

A bit odd especially when you search and scroll as many properties as we do, it is hard to remember one from the other.

We finally found a spot to stop for some lunch ... and my thoughts initially were "Are you serious, you want to eat here?"  

The parking lot was full, the outside appeared "down market" and more like a local watering hole.


                         


                

Once we entered we were pleasantly surprised to see many patrons enjoying delicious food and beverages, in a clean rustic setting.

Lesson learned "Don't judge a book by its cover".

We were seated at a window table with views of the highway ... as I looked out I saw a sign ...
"art30A" ... 


After our lunch we checked out the property across the road and sure enough it was the same place we had looked at many years ago; the apartment was located above the owner's art studio.

Unfortunately it was not open today ...

                              
 

What a pleasant surprise ...

Who would have thought you would see a place you had viewed many years ago on the Internet with limited info as to its location!

Often when we are searching for accommodation for our travels, we comment how it would be nice to know where the property is located and be able to see it ahead of time.

Now we use Google earth to get a visual impression of the area.
